Took the Leonard 66H out today, along with my Clearwater fast graphite with an indicator. Boy was that an odd feeling switching back and forth. After a couple turns the indicator rod just got set aside, the bamboo rod just felt so much more alive.

Dropped the inexpensive reel I got from Greywolf. Here I got it loaded with a WF5 sink tip. While I've fished 5's and 5.5's, I really felt it would have loaded better with a 6 for today's single wet fly application. A 5 works well with an indicator. Lots of trying still to do.

Found this rods best fish so far. Fit and angry. After two hot runs ending in showy leaps, at which point I was a couple turns from the backing, I started getting the better of it.

Had 2 hooks with leader in it's gut, one running all the way to a swivel. Nice and pink, I bet it'll be yummy at dinner time. My wife is stoked.
